LRA Search is seeking an Office Manager & EA based in the West End, London. This permanent, full-time role involves running the office function, providing EA-level support to the CEO and Senior Leadership Team, and participating in operational projects.
The ideal candidate has experience in office management or EA support, is organized, personable, and capable of engaging with senior stakeholders.
A competitive salary of up to £55,000 plus a 20% bonus is offered, with a 5-day-a-week office presence required.

How to prepare for a job interview at LRA Search
✨Know Your Role Inside Out
Before the interview, make sure you thoroughly understand the responsibilities of an Executive Assistant and Office Manager. Familiarise yourself with the specific tasks mentioned in the job description, like running office functions and supporting senior leadership. This will help you demonstrate your knowledge and show that you're genuinely interested in the role.
✨Showcase Your Organisational Skills
As an EA and Office Manager, being organised is key. Prepare examples from your past experience where your organisational skills made a difference. Whether it’s managing schedules or coordinating projects, having concrete examples ready will impress the interviewers and highlight your suitability for the role.
✨Engage with Senior Stakeholders
Since the role involves engaging with senior stakeholders, practice how you would communicate with them. Think about how to present your ideas clearly and confidently. During the interview, be prepared to discuss how you’ve successfully interacted with senior management in the past, showcasing your personable nature.
✨Prepare Questions That Matter
Interviews are a two-way street, so come prepared with thoughtful questions about the company culture, team dynamics, and operational projects. This not only shows your interest but also helps you assess if the company is the right fit for you. Tailor your questions to reflect your understanding of the role and the company’s goals.
